Are there any fees associated with modifying a return flight?

When it comes to modifying a return flight, fees can vary significantly depending on the airline and the fare class of your ticket. Most airlines have specific policies regarding changes, so it's important to check the terms and conditions associated with your booking. Many airlines offer flexible or refundable tickets that allow for changes with little to no fees, but these options tend to be pricier. On the other hand, non-refundable tickets often come with fees that can range anywhere from a small surcharge to the full cost of the fare, depending on how close you are to your departure date and the airline's specific policies.

In addition to change fees, you should also consider potential fare differences. If your new flight is more expensive than your original booking, you will generally need to pay the difference in price on top of any applicable change fees. Conversely, if the new flight is cheaper, some airlines may offer a credit for the difference, while others may not provide any refund at all. It’s wise to contact the airline directly or check their website to get the most accurate information regarding your situation, as policies can change frequently and may differ based on your specific circumstances.
